• Dig In! Tree, Bulb & Native Perennial Grant

    Community Organizations
  • ELIGIBILITY: This program supports community organizations, youth organizations, faith-based organizations, municipal “adopt-a-lot” programs, garden clubs, green teams, and energetic community members looking to spearhead a public greening project located in Passaic County. 

    Applications are due August 10th, 2023, at 11.59 pm EST

    ALL PROJECTS MUST: 

    • Have a minimum of 3 adults committed to the project
    • Be highly visible to the public and provide an positive impact to the neighborhood
    • Have workable soil on-site, at least 6 hours of sun exposure, and access to water (tree and perennial grants only)
    • Be completed before November 30th, 2023

    NOT ELIGIBLE:

    • Projects outside of Passaic County.
    • Schools (Contact elatham@city-green.org for school garden inquiries)
    • Commercial for-profit entities
    • Private Residences

    GRANT REQUIREMENTS​:

    • Provide before, during and after photos of the project
    • Use appropriate hashtags when posting on social media and distribute a press release about the grant and planting day (hashtags and press release template provided by City Green).
    • Project must be completed by November 30, 2023

     

    GRANT AWARDS AVAILABLE

    • Daffodil bulbs in amounts of 100, 300 or 500 bulbs
    • Native Eastern Redbud Trees in amounts of 1, 2 or 3 trees
    • Dig In! Native, Perennial Package $250 value (about 40 plants)
      • Available to returning grantees only
      • Plant species to include rudbekia, echinacea, aster, panicum virgatum, culvers root and more.
      • Full sun, part sun / shade, and wet site packages available upon request.
